Comment: I am a CPA and have extensive knowledge of the federal tax system. The AMT tax is the most burdensome tax system this country has ever dreamed up for both individuals and businesses. Last year treasurey secretary John Snow estimated an AMT fix would cost $700 B. I don't understand why it has to cost anything. You could eliminate AMT and increase the graduated tax rates for those groups of taxpayers the AMT is trying to tax (for example the upper tax brackets. Then, the elimination of the AMT would not cause any additional increase on the taxpayers since they are already paying the tax anyway. Moving the tax from what is called "AMT" to a "regular tax" would not burden the economy at all and it is simple! What is so difficult about that? Also remember the taxpayers are paying accountants alot of time to plan and prepare AMT tax forms. I hate to admit it, but paying accountants to prepare AMT tax forms adds no value to our economy. It is only a hidden tax which the taxpayers must bare and businesses must include the cost in the products they sell. Please eliminate the AMT tax at a minimum.
